Asystasioside E structure

Asystasioside E

TL;DR: Asystasioside E (CAS 126005-85-4) is a chemical compound with molecular formula C15H23ClO10 and molecular weight 398.10 g/mol, supplied by Kehong Biological (Henan Kehong Biological Technology Co., Ltd.) with CRO/CDMO custom synthesis services.

(2S,3S,4R,5R,6S)-6-[[(4aR)-7-hydroxy-7-(hydroxymethyl)-4a,5,6,7a-tetrahydro-1H-cyclopenta[c]pyran-1-yl]oxy]-2-[chloro(hydroxy)methyl]oxane-2,3,4,5-tetrol

Also Known As: Asystasioside E, (2S,3S,4R,5R,6S)-6-[[(4aR)-7-hydroxy-7-(hydroxymethyl)-4a,5,6,7a-tetrahydro-1H-cyclopenta[c]pyran-1-yl]oxy]-2-[chloro(hydroxy)methyl]oxane-2,3,4,5-tetrol

CAS: 126005-85-4
Molecular Formula C15H23ClO10
Molecular Weight 398.10 g/mol
LogP -2.3
Topological Polar Surface Area 169.0 Ų
Hydrogen Bond Donors 7
Hydrogen Bond Acceptors 10
Rotatable Bonds 4
Exact Mass 398.09796
Heavy Atoms 26
Complexity 549.0

Chemical Identifiers

CAS Number 126005-85-4
SMILES C1CC(C2[C@H]1C=COC2O[C@@H]3[C@@H]([C@H]([C@@H]([C@](O3)(C(O)Cl)O)O)O)O)(CO)O
InChIKey XSPPZAOBLKWRDZ-KMTJDOOMSA-N

Property Insights of Asystasioside E

The XLogP value of -2.3 indicates that Asystasioside E is hydrophilic (water-soluble), making it suitable for aqueous formulations and biological assay applications. The TPSA of 169.0 Ų indicates high polarity, suggesting Asystasioside E may have limited membrane permeability but good aqueous solubility. Following Lipinski's Rule of Five, Asystasioside E has 7 hydrogen bond donor(s) and 10 hydrogen bond acceptor(s), which may warrant consideration for formulation optimization.
